PAH Team of the Year Award 2023

Aim

The aim of this award is to recognise the contributions of a PAH team who has demonstrated peak performance through: cutting-edge research; exemplary quality improvement; and/or other exemplary innovations with positive outcomes in alignment with the strategic priorities of the organisation.

Eligibility

To be eligible the application must consist of a:

  • Nurse/s of any level working within any unit or team outlined within the PAH Organisational Structure (PDF, 655.11 KB)
  • Joint Appointments, Visiting Scholars, Research Fellows that meet the aims outlined above and included nursing clinicians at the PAH as part of the innovation.
  • Nurse/s must have assumed a leadership role within the team and/or had a significant contribution in the achievement of outcomes.

Criteria

Submit a maximum of 500 words which addresses each of the following:

  • Outline the Nursing Strategic Priority that was addressed by undertaking this innovation/initiative
  • Outline the name of the innovation
  • List the team members names and positions
  • Briefly describe the problem
  • Goal (outline the intended goal i.e. what was the desired outcome of this innovation/initiative?)
  • Intervention (explain in detail what was done? When did it occur?)
  • Outcomes (what was achieved?)

Decision making governance process

Nominations will be judged by a panel that consists of nursing executive; interprofessional colleague; and a consumer representative from the PAH. Each member will have equal voting rights, although in the event of a conflict of interest (i.e. nominee is from respective work unit) these rights will be rescinded. The panel will utilise a Likert scale from ‘Strongly Agree that Applicant Meets Criteria to Strongly Disagree that Applicant Meets Criteria’ to assist in determining the top 5 nominations and recommend a winner of the award. The top 3 nominations and recommended winner will be tabled at the Nursing Director/Assistant Director of Nursing (ND/ADON) Committee Meeting. The ND/ADON committee will endorse the final decision. The top 3 teams will be notified and invited to the award presentation for the announcement of the award winner.

Please note: The education bursary will be equally shared amongst the recipients.
